如何用java編寫exe程序
隨著Java的流行和應(yīng)用越來(lái)越廣泛,對(duì)于使用Java編寫可執(zhí)行文件的需求也越來(lái)越高。在本文中,我們將詳細(xì)介紹如何通過(guò)Java編寫可執(zhí)行文件的步驟,并提供一個(gè)具體的示例,以幫助讀者更好地理解和掌握這一技
隨著Java的流行和應(yīng)用越來(lái)越廣泛,對(duì)于使用Java編寫可執(zhí)行文件的需求也越來(lái)越高。在本文中,我們將詳細(xì)介紹如何通過(guò)Java編寫可執(zhí)行文件的步驟,并提供一個(gè)具體的示例,以幫助讀者更好地理解和掌握這一技術(shù)。
步驟一: 環(huán)境配置
首先,確保你已經(jīng)安裝了Java Development Kit (JDK)。可以在命令行中輸入"javac -version"來(lái)檢查是否成功安裝。
步驟二: 編寫代碼
創(chuàng)建一個(gè)新的Java源文件,例如"",然后在此文件中編寫Java代碼。你可以使用任何文本編輯器來(lái)完成這個(gè)過(guò)程。下面是一個(gè)簡(jiǎn)單的示例代碼:
```java
public class Main {
public static void main(String[] args) {
("Hello World!");
}
}
```
以上代碼會(huì)在控制臺(tái)輸出"Hello World!"。
步驟三: 編譯代碼
打開(kāi)命令行窗口,進(jìn)入到存儲(chǔ)源代碼的目錄,并使用javac命令來(lái)編譯代碼。在命令行中輸入以下命令:
```
javac
```
這將會(huì)生成一個(gè)名為""的字節(jié)碼文件。
步驟四: 打包可執(zhí)行文件
使用jar命令將生成的字節(jié)碼文件打包成可執(zhí)行文件。在命令行中輸入以下命令:
```
jar cvfe Main.jar Main
```
其中,"Main.jar"是你想要打包的可執(zhí)行文件的名稱,"Main"是指定程序入口的主類名,""是要包含的類文件。
至此,你已成功地用Java編寫了一個(gè)可執(zhí)行文件??梢酝ㄟ^(guò)雙擊或者在命令行中輸入"java -jar Main.jar"來(lái)運(yùn)行該程序。
示例演示:
現(xiàn)在我們以一個(gè)簡(jiǎn)單的計(jì)算器程序?yàn)槔瑏?lái)演示如何使用Java編寫可執(zhí)行文件。
```java
import ;
public class Calculator {
public static void main(String[] args) {
Scanner scanner new Scanner();
("請(qǐng)輸入第一個(gè)數(shù)字:");
int num1 ();
("請(qǐng)輸入第二個(gè)數(shù)字:");
int num2 ();
("請(qǐng)選擇操作符 ( , -, *, /):");
String operator ();
int result 0;
switch (operator) {
case " ":
result num1 num2;
break;
case "-":
result num1 - num2;
break;
case "*":
result num1 * num2;
break;
case "/":
result num1 / num2;
break;
default:
("無(wú)效的操作符");
}
("計(jì)算結(jié)果為: " result);
}
}
```
通過(guò)上述代碼,我們實(shí)現(xiàn)了一個(gè)簡(jiǎn)單的計(jì)算器程序,用戶可以輸入兩個(gè)數(shù)字和運(yùn)算符進(jìn)行計(jì)算,最后輸出結(jié)果。
接下來(lái),按照之前介紹的步驟,將代碼編譯并打包成可執(zhí)行文件。然后你就可以雙擊運(yùn)行該程序,進(jìn)行簡(jiǎn)單的計(jì)算操作了。
總結(jié):
本文詳細(xì)介紹了使用Java編寫可執(zhí)行文件的步驟,并提供了一個(gè)簡(jiǎn)單的示例來(lái)幫助讀者更好地理解和應(yīng)用這一技術(shù)。通過(guò)掌握這些基礎(chǔ)知識(shí),你將能夠使用Java編寫各種實(shí)用的可執(zhí)行文件,滿足你的編程需求。希望本文能對(duì)你有所幫助!